Riley Green was doing what he does best on stage in Nashville on Saturday (Apr. 18), keeping the crowd in the palm of his hand as they sang along to every word.
But it was those same words that got the crowd at the Bridgestone Arena fired up when Green got to his song, “Hell of A Way To Go.”
He brought out Drake White to join him on the song, which includes the lyric “Watchin’ Alabama whoop up on Tennessee.” That didn’t go over well with the Vols-loving crowd.
After letting the boos go on for a bit, Green started toying with the crowd by saying “We are not Alabama fans, so y’all can relax about that.”
Flashing his sense of humor, Green then circled back for the punchline: “We’re Auburn fans.”

Being the amazing entertainer that Green is, he knew he could and was successfully taking the crowd on an emotional roller coaster that he knew exactly when to stop.
“I’ve only done this one other time, but I’m gonna do it tonight because y’all are a great crowd,” the singer said.

“If y’all promise not to video it, I’ll change the lyrics one time,” He continued. Then, he sang “Alabama’s getting the hell kicked out of them by Tennessee,” which seemed to win the crowd back.
